Body found near school

2 min read

Police were investigating the death of a man found Friday morning next to the Kahului Elementary School campus.

A man's lifeless body was found at 6:46 a.m. near the campus at 410 S. Hina Ave., police said.

The area near the body was closed off while police investigated the scene.

Police spokesman Lt. Gregg Okamoto confirmed there was an ongoing investigation.

Police reported finding "no obvious signs of foul play or suspicious injuries."

In a letter to parents, faculty and staff, school Principal Keoni Wilhelm said police were investigating the death of an individual that took place overnight.

"Staff who were on campus during the early-morning hours before school starts immediately took action in cooperation with emergency services to redirect students away from the scene," he said.

Students remained safe, and classes were unaffected, Wilhelm said.

"This loss has deeply affected our school community," he said, extending "our deepest condolences" to the man's family and friends.

Kahului Elementary School counselors and behavioral health specialists were available to help students and staff members, he said.

Wilhelm said that he could not confirm whether students saw the man's body. He said students were "grieving" and "unable to articulate what they saw."
